Brand Image

Sustainability is no longer just a buzzword. It’s a key factor influencing consumer decisions, shaping how they view brands and whether they’ll choose to support them. People are increasingly drawn to businesses that demonstrate eco-friendly practices, and those that don’t risk being left behind. Yet, embracing sustainability doesn’t have to be a daunting task for your business. By making small, realistic changes and being transparent about your efforts, you can strengthen your brand image and win consumer trust. Here’s why sustainability matters and how you can integrate it into your operations.

Why Sustainability Shapes Perception

Today’s consumers are more eco-conscious than ever, and they’re paying attention to how brands behave. Eco-friendly businesses that reduce waste or adopt greener practices are more likely to earn the trust and loyalty of customers. For example, retailers who switch to recyclable packaging or offer reusable product options are seen as responsible, helping to build a stronger connection with their audience.

These efforts go beyond marketing buzz; they genuinely influence how consumers perceive the brand. When you demonstrate a clear commitment to sustainability, your customers notice and appreciate it, rewarding you with their continued business.

Practical Steps to Embed Sustainability

Adopting sustainable practices doesn’t need to be an overwhelming challenge. Small, manageable steps can make a significant impact over time. One of the easiest ways to get started is by switching to renewable energy. Reducing your reliance on non-renewable resources not only helps the environment, but it can also cut energy costs in the long run.

In addition to transitioning to greener energy sources, consider how you can reduce waste and energy consumption. Implementing energy-efficient lighting and cutting down on plastic usage can all contribute to a more sustainable operation. For example, partnering with a business energy provider that supports sustainable practices can help you monitor your energy use and find more efficient ways to operate.

Communicate Your Efforts Transparently

Customers value transparency, especially when it comes to sustainability. Instead of vague claims about your efforts, focus on measurable progress. Brands can build trust by publishing detailed reports on their environmental impact and the steps they’ve taken to improve. This way, brands don’t just say they care; they show it.

Honest communication fosters credibility and strengthens your brand’s relationship with its audience.

The Long-Term Brand Benefits

Sustainability is not a quick fix; it’s a long-term strategy. However, the benefits of embracing it can significantly impact your business. Companies that prioritise sustainability often see increased customer loyalty and a stronger brand reputation. Over time, these benefits translate into a competitive advantage, as more consumers choose to support businesses that align with their values.

As sustainability becomes a growing priority, the companies that get ahead of the curve will be the ones that thrive.

A Commitment that Pays Off

By taking practical steps today, you’re setting yourself up for long-term success. Your efforts will not only improve your brand image but also help build a loyal customer base that appreciates your dedication to the environment.

Sustainability may not offer instant results, but over time, it will pay off in ways that matter to both your customers and your business.
